Abstract
It the utility model is related to chip mounter technical field, a kind of in particular loader for chip mounter, including fixed bottom plate, material-receiving device and the vertical columns being arranged at the top of fixed bottom plate, it is equipped between material-receiving device and vertical columns and draws material track, feed sliding block is equipped between material-receiving device and vertical columns, mobile row bar is installed on feed sliding block, mobile row bar is equipped with beam, tensile axis and cylinder lagging are equipped between feed sliding block and material-receiving device, feeder channel is equipped with the top of material-receiving device, material-receiving device is equipped with splicing arm.This is used for the feeding machine of chip mounter, easy to use, while Automatic-feeding is met so that the feed efficiency of chip mounter greatly improves, and saves manpower, suitable for promoting and using on a large scale.
